Is 3210-3240 Geary Blvd rent-controlled?

San Francisco's Rent Ordinance caps rent increases and provides eviction protection for most residential units built before 1979 with 2+ units. Here's how this building scores.

The 31-unit apartment building at 3216-3240 Geary Blvd, owned by Gene & Angela Lam 2003 Mari, was constructed in 1964 as a three-story multi-family residential property and has undergone numerous significant improvements and faced several challenges over the years. Most recently, in 2024, the building has seen substantial electrical upgrades, including the replacement of interior house panels and apartment subpanels, along with re-roofing work completed at a cost of $58,280. The property has focused on accessibility improvements, with the installation of an exterior lift in 2023 under the Accessible Business Entrance program, though earlier attempts to implement this feature had to be revised or withdrawn.

The building's history reveals attention to safety updates, particularly in 2021, when low-frequency sounders were installed in compliance with fire safety regulations, and the fire alarm control panel was replaced. Recent complaints from 2023-2024 have primarily centered around the on-site Prik Hom restaurant, with issues reported regarding unauthorized fan installation, noise, and ventilation concerns that required multiple permits and emergency repairs to resolve. The building has completed its soft-story retrofit requirements under Tier 2, achieving compliance with current seismic safety standards. Historical violations from 2001, including egress obstructions and fire extinguisher issues, were addressed and closed. Various plumbing improvements have been made over the years, including water heater and boiler replacements, and the building's infrastructure has received ongoing maintenance attention through regular permit applications.

How 3210-3240 Geary Blvd's risk score is calculated

We trained a model on 7 years of SF DBI inspection data — notice of violation filings, complaint history, and owner track records. It estimates the probability that DBI inspectors will issue a Notice of Violation at this address in the next 12 months. Lower % = safer.
